The LCL Awards Core Domestic Gas Safety (CCN1) course, along with additional modules, MET1, and CENWAT, HTR1, CKR1 & CPA is designed for individuals looking to gain or renew their qualifications to work on domestic gas appliances in the UK. Successful completion of the Core Domestic Gas Safety (CCN1) is a prerequisite for undertaking any of the appliance-specific modules.

The LCL Awards ACS (Accredited Certification Scheme) Assessment – MET1: Domestic Gas Meters is designed for gas engineers seeking certification or re-assessment to install, commission, and maintain domestic gas meters. Successful completion of this module is essential for those who need to work with gas meters safely and in compliance with industry standards. The MET1 assessment is recognised by the Gas Safe Register, which allows engineers to work legally on domestic gas meter installations in the UK.
